Ram babu donated 3% of his income to a charity and deposited 12% of the rest in bank. If now he has Rs.12804, then his income was:
1). Rs.17460
2). Rs.15000
3). Rs.7500
4). Rs.14550

.Let Ram Babu’s salary be Rs. x.
Remaining amount after donations
to charity

= Rs.$\frac{97x}{100}$

After depositing money in the
bank,
Remaining amount

x = $\frac{12804\times10000}{97\times88}$  = 15000
